Google Supports Hope for Children Foundation with Sizeable Donation

 

Dallas, TX -- (SBWIRE) -- 09/01/2016 -- Google, Inc. just awarded Hope For Children Foundation, corporate headquarters in Dallas, TX, a sizeable donation to support the mission of Hope For Children Foundation. The market value of the In-Kind is about $480,000 over the next twelve months.

In the past year and a half, Google has supported the mission of Hope For Children Foundation by donating significantly to the cause, in the amount of about $190,000. This donation benefits children and families throughout the United States.

About Hope For Children Foundation
Hope For Children Foundation, an acknowledged leader in America. Since 1998, Hope For Children Foundation, has been providing educational services to state and federal law enforcement personnel, medical professionals, judges, attorneys, probation officers as well as to the public regarding child abuse prevention and related issues, using the mark Hope For Children Foundation. A child abuse prevention event is held almost every weekend, each year by Hope For Children Foundation, with its name publicly displayed.

Some of the videos cover important healing steps for victims and their families, how to better protect children and adults from crimes of domestic violence - including abuse prevention, elderly abuse help is also available since sometimes a child may be in the same home, human trafficking, the investigation and prosecution procedures surrounding abuse to children and adults, many more topics are available. This children's charity has been recognized by state and federal governments, including but not limited to the US Justice Department, Office of Justice Programs, Violence Against Women Office. The Violence Against Women Act, offers protection to women, children and men on a federal level.
